TRANSPORT OFFICER (Programme Team)

1. CO-ORDINATION & REVIEW OF TRANSPORT
a) will co-ordinate with the Programme Chair, Adjutants and C.O. (and Safety Officer, if appointed) on strategy and other transport matters and, as a member of the Programme Team, is responsible for:
b) to review the number of available drivers at camp including authorised minibus drivers.
c) will co-ordinating passenger requirements and organising the transport for the Camp to and from events.
d) will allocate passengers to vehicles.
e) will ensure that drivers have log books recording passenger names, destinations and times.

2. LEGAL REQUIREMENT CHECKS
a) that all drivers are in possession of a valid license for driving the particular class of vehicle and are insured for that vehicle.
b) that all drivers hold copies of insurance and MOT certificates for the vehicle they are driving (also applies to mini-buses).
c) that all vehicles have a current MOT for the duration of Camp (Saturday-Saturday) and that all vehicles are road-worthy.
d) that private vehicles used for transporting any Camper are also MOT'd and insured.
e) that all minibuses carry a mobile first aid kit.

3. ROUTE PLANNING
a)    ensures that drivers are provided with either route maps or directions to and from venues.
b) ensures that there is safe passage for vehicles entering and exiting the camp site (liaising with the Safety Officer, if appointed).

4. CHURCH PARADE TRANSPORT
a) the Transport Officer will liaise with the CO regarding the timings to transport the camp to and from the drop-off and collection points.
b) the most efficient method of transporting the camp will be planned and seats will be allocated on cars and mini-buses by consulting the drivers.
c) enough time should be calculated to get the camp to the drop-off point in time for the parade and band to assemble and move off in time to reach the Church allowing at least 10 minutes arrival before the Church Service starts.
d) it is a matter of urgency that the whole camp is mobilised to travel to and from the Church Parade venue.

5. TRANSPORT OFFICER'S REMIT
a) the Transport Officer is only responsible for transport during Camp.
b) individual Companies are responsible for transport to and from Camp.

The Transport Officer is accountable to the Programme Team Leader and the Camp C.O..
